The first step to building a strong web development process is defining your goal. What do you want your website to accomplish? It’s easy to say you want your site to be easy-to-use and mobile-friendly, but what does that mean? To write an effective web development process, first, sit down and make a list of things you know for sure about your website: Features it should have; How users will use it; what type of design (if any) will work best for you. In general, writing out specific goals for your website can help keep a larger project on track. The more granular your goals are, and the more clear they are from day one, everything else should fall into place naturally as time goes on.

There are hundreds of web development companies out there, all of them eager to help you with your project. However, not all of them offer top-notch services and quality. If you want to make sure that you choose only from the best web development firms in the UK, consider asking for recommendations and referrals from friends or colleagues who have used these firms for their own projects before. You can also check their portfolio online to see if they have past work samples that will give you an idea of how professional and skilled they are. Once you’ve picked three companies whose portfolios impress you, set up a meeting with them (in person if possible) to ask any questions and discuss your project requirements so they can tell you what it’ll take to complete it.
